What Are Collaborative Robots (Cobots)? Collaborative robots, widely known as cobots, are revolutionizing the industrial landscape by enabling humans and robots to work side by side. Unlike traditional robots, which operate in isolated environments, cobots are designed to interact safely and efficiently with human workers, making them a key asset in today’s manufacturing processes.
